Yes I did
My list was:
VESSERY (VI)
OMEGA LEADER (Comm Relay and Juke)
ZETA LEADER (Comm Relay and Wired)
WAMPA
And, Biophysical, it was initially inspired by your Rexlar + 3 Epsilons build I saw a while ago in the Squad Lists forum. Then I made my own tweaks over the course of a couple months!

It's really the FO TIEs, I think, that have by extension enabled Defenders to make a comeback outside of lists like the Jonus Brothers, which has some horrible matchups, and the Double-Defender list that requires an epic-tier player to pull off. Previously, there wasn't a lot in my mind that made great partners for a fully tooled-up Defender - I flew Vessery with Phantoms, and shuttles, and Decimators, but it always felt like something was lacking. For Vessery especially, the FO TIEs provide an excellent platform to get your target locks (And crucially, get multiple if you need them) and still have longevity with Comm Relay - being able to take the TL and still have your defensive action is phenomenal. Plus, with their cheap aces, you have a lot of options to run them with. I admit I haven't figured out Rexlar yet entirely, but I am working on it!
